Output d953496614be8101414bedfb1d26c2a3446741fea9fe8ed8fbc1ba578c1be1e5:1

value
255000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ed530ae2375a1eab213e56a15ec11f93eb1ea2 OP_EQUAL
address
3Cd8dxa36VQ8BwxzDnzALE3xjnEMHHAVpT
transaction
d953496614be8101414bedfb1d26c2a3446741fea9fe8ed8fbc1ba578c1be1e5
spent
true